Men’s swimming and diving beats West Chester 136.5-106.5

10/22/2011 3:27:00 AM | Men's Swimming and Diving

WEST CHESTER, Pa. – The Lehigh men's swimming and diving team won its second straight meet to open the season as the Mountain Hawks defeated West Chester 136.5-106.5 on Friday night. Lehigh won 7-of-13 events and in the events it didn't win, got important points with second and third place finishes.
 
Lehigh set the tone early in the 400 yard medley relay as senior Christopher Toth, junior Alex Aboud, senior Kevin Shoemaker and junior Frank Cuzzola captured first place with a time of 3:34.03.
 
While the Mountain Hawks were unable to capture first in the next event - the 1000 yard freestyle – Lehigh freshmen Danny Bennett (9.50.89) and Jake Green (10:03.43) took second and third place respectively.
 
It was a photo finish in the third race as Toth tied West Chester's swimmer for first place with a time of 1:45.91 while junior Frank Cuzzola took third (1:47.27).
 
Lehigh kept rolling as junior Demetri Karedis won the 50 yard freestyle with a time of 21.17 while sophomore Chris Hoke placed third (21.86). In the next race, it was Shoemaker (1:57.82) and Aboud (1:58.61) that took the top two sports respectively in the 200 yard IM.
 
It was Shoemaker again in the 200 yard butterfly as he took first with a time of 1:54.90 while Jeffrey Capobianco was third (2:04.89).
 
In the 100 yard freestyle, Karedis took second and Hoke took third with times of 22.56 and 22.68 respectively.
Lehigh then took first and third in the 200 yard backstroke as Toth won it with a time of 28.57 and freshman Sean Brant was third (28.26).
 
In the 500 yard freestyle, Bennett placed second with a time of 26.53. And then in the 200 yard breaststroke, Aboud placed first with a time of 30.69 while freshman John Lorentzan placed third (31.32).
 
On the diving boards, senior John Styles placed third in the one meter, scoring 244.30 points while junior Michael Harshman was right behind him in fourth with 217.30 points. The duo along with freshman Daniel Bateman finished 3-4-5 in the three meter.
 
In the final race of the meet - the 400 yard freestyle relay - Lehigh took first as Cuzzola, Hoke, Karedis and Bennett won the race with a time of 3:10.35.
 
The Mountain Hawks will return to the pool on Saturday, October 29th to host Colgate at Jacobs Pool at 1 p.m. Lehigh defeated Colgate last season 196-94.
